The US Head of Gross-to-Net (GTN) is a strategic leadership role within Sanofi’s North America Finance organization, reporting to North America CFO, accountable for the integrity and strategic direction of GTN forecasting, reporting, and reserve governance. This leader provides financial stewardship over gross-to-net outcomes and related net sales close processes, ensuring disciplined governance, strong controls, and executive-ready insights that shape pricing, market access, and commercial strategy.
GTN is one of the largest and most complex drivers of U.S. net sales and cash, and this role plays a critical part in translating market and policy dynamics into financial performance. You will partner closely in partnership with Finance Business Partners, Market Access, and other critical stakeholders to align assumptions, resolve variances, and strengthen forecast accuracy and transparency.
The role plays a key part in Sanofi’s Finance transformation agenda by modernizing how GTN insights are generated and consumed. This includes advancing automation, advanced analytics, and AI-enabled forecasting and scenario modeling to surface risks earlier, accelerate decision-making, and improve planning confidence while maintaining appropriate governance and controls.

Main Responsibilities:
Provide financial stewardship over $45B+ in gross sales, ensuring alignment between accounting, forecasting, performance analytics, and cash flow implications.
Lead and develop a high-performing organization of ~15 team members with ~6 direct reports, including clear decision rights, escalation paths, and succession planning.
Lead GTN reserve governance: Own quarterly GTN reserve analysis and adequacy reviews, ensuring reserves are accurate, risks/opportunities are identified early, and key assumptions and rates are well captured.
Own GTN forecasting cadence: Lead GTN forecasting and actuals processes in partnership with GBUs, Finance Business Partners, Market Access; drive alignment, transparency, and forecast accuracy.
Deliver decision-shaping insights: Provide financial insights on GTN programs, payer/channel mix, product launches, and contract structures to support leadership decisions.
Evaluate pricing and access impacts: Assess the financial impact of pricing strategies, market access programs, and payer negotiations; translate assumptions into clear implications for profitability and performance.
Lead cross-functional alignment: Lead cross-functional sessions to align assumptions, resolve variances, and improve forecast accuracy.
Ensure close, controls, and audit readiness: Oversee governance of net sales close activities and supporting GTN processes; serve as the senior point of contact for internal/external audits and ensure strong evidence and remediation discipline.
Lead and develop the CoE: Drive process improvements, automation, and AI-enabled forecasting and scenario modeling (e.g., early-warning indicators and anomaly detection) to increase speed, transparency, and consistency across forecasting, reserves, and close.
